GENTOO LINUX SECURITY ANNOUNCEMENT 200303-12
- - ---------------------------------------------------------------------

- - ---------------------------------------------------------------------
- From advisory:
"Under certain conditions it is possible to execute arbitrary code using a buffer overflow in the recent qpopper.
You need a valid username/password-combination and code is (depending on the setup) usually executed with the user's uid and gid mail."
Read the full advisory at: http://marc.theaimsgroup.com/?l=bugtraq&m=104739841223916&w=2
SOLUTION
It is recommended that all Gentoo Linux users who are running net-mail/qpopper upgrade to qpopper-4.0.5 as follows:
emerge sync emerge qpopper emerge clean

PACKAGE : qpopper
SUMMARY : buffer overflow
DATE : 2003-03-17 09:50 UTC
EXPLOIT : remote
VERSIONS AFFECTED : <4.0.5 : fixed version>=4.0.5
CVE : CAN-2003-0143
